Programmes are divided into two categories - those with audio on the web, and those only broadcast via radio and live streaming.

Programmes with Audio

Business News
Today's top business news.
Checkpoint
Mary Wilson presents the day's major national and international stories.
Focus on Politics
A weekly analysis of significant political issues.
Insight
A weekly current affairs programme of national and international interest.
Mediawatch
Mediawatch looks critically at the New Zealand media - television, radio, newspapers and magazines as well as the 'new' electronic media.
Midday Report
Radio New Zealand news followed by business, rural and sports news, plus the long range weather forecast and Worldwatch.
Morning Report
Authoritative and comprehensive coverage of local and world events.
Nights
Unfurling fresh ideas and sounds along with the best radio documentaries and features from here and overseas.
Nine To Noon
From nine to noon every weekday, the Nine to Noon team investigate everything from hard news to lifestyle issues.
Rural News
Rural events and people.

Programmes broadcast only on the radio

Late Edition
The most significant news stories, news interviews and packages of the day.
Worldwatch
International news and news reports.
